Taking Care Of Your Wooden Furniture

30 June 2010 235 views No Comment

One of the best ways to give your house a pleasant look is by furnishing it with wooden furniture. And if you have decided that wooden furniture is the perfect choice for your house, then you should also know that this furniture needs a proper maintenance. Wooden furniture requires a little more care than other furniture, but if you really want to make your house look beautiful, then it is worth it. The biggest reason for wooden furniture to lose its looks and life is the irregular maintenance and care or total absence of care. If you want your wooden furniture to look great and have a longer life, then remember these tips and follow them.

The first maintenance advice is to dust your wooden furniture regularly. Dusting is the best way to care about your wooden furniture, because it prevents dust and other unnecessary objects from settling on your furniture. Dust doesn’t allow your furniture look glossy and sheen, making the material weaker as well. But you should also do the dusting very carefully. If there is something standing on top of the furniture, make sure you always pick it up. Never slide the objects from side to side, because it may scratch your furniture and damage it for good.

You should always keep the wooden furniture away from water and other liquids. While your wood has polish on it, water will not be able to seep in and damage the material, but when the material begins to wear out, any liquid will seep into the wood and destroy its texture.

It is also important to keep your wooden furniture away from direct sunlight, unless it is absolutely necessary. If you have no other way but keep the wooden furniture under the direct sunlight, then make sure you use some kind of shield or table cloth. Direct sunlight can easily damage furniture made of wood.

Furniture made of wood is weaker than the one made of steel or iron, so whenever you are cleaning or moving it, make sure you don’t drag it. Lift it instead. This will keep your furniture strong and intact, keeping your tiles undamaged as well.

Polishing your wooden furniture is good, but don’t polish it too much. Three or four polishes a year is good for wooden furniture. Too much polish during the polishing process is also bad. Excessive polish use may lead to a kind of a film on the furniture.
